Tax Help Associates Inc





Business Profile: Contact Information, Customer Reviews, Rating & Accreditation, Customer Complaints, Business Details

Photos

Tax Help Associates Inc




Description

Contacts

Address:
980 Winter St, Waltham, MA 02451






Features






Reviews

Write a review

Related